Description
The MP8845C is a highly integrated and high frequency synchronous step-down switcher with I2C control interface. It is optimized to support up to 5A load current over an input supply range from 2.7V to 6V with excellent load and line regulation.
Constant frequency hysteretic control mode provides extremely fast transient response without loop compensation and easily achieves high efficiency under light load condition.
The output voltage level can be controlled, on-the fly through a 3.4Mbps I2C serial interface. Voltage range can be adjusted from 0.6V to 1.45V in 6.69mV steps. Voltage slew rate, switching frequency and power savings mode are also selectable through the I2C interface.
Fully protection features includes internal soft start, over current protection and over temperature protection.
The MP8845C requires a minimum number of readily available standard external components and is available in the compact WLCSP20-1.70mmx2.10mm package.
